Clashes Erupt in Bordeaux Between Rival Western Sahara Protesters

While Moroccans residing in Bordeaux were demonstrating their support for the Moroccanness of the Sahara on Saturday on the Place de la Victoire, other demonstrators in favor of the "Saharawis" arrived on the scene. The two rallies degenerated into clashes.
It was 1 p.m. this Saturday, December 12, when about thirty members of the Moroccan community in Bordeaux gathered on the Place de la Victoire in support of Morocco’s territorial claims over the Western Sahara, reports Sud Ouest.
A few minutes later, about thirty other demonstrators supporting the "Saharawis" invaded the premises. Peaceful at first, these two rallies quickly degenerated with some altercations and provocations. The police had to intervene in large numbers to calm the spirits.
These demonstrations come the day after the American recognition of Morocco’s sovereignty over the Western Sahara.
